**Q: My old badge stopped working after the Meridex migration. What do I do?**

As part of Calverton House's switch to the Meridex door system, all legacy badges were deactivated at the end of last quarter. New starters receive a Meridex-compatible badge on day one, but the turnstiles on floors two and four still require a temporary fallback code until the readers are upgraded. Until then, enter the code below at any amber-lit reader.

turnstile pass: bdg-QZV-3

**Receiptpost API — Send Endpoint**

The Receiptpost mailer exposes a single `POST /receipts` endpoint that accepts a donation record and returns a delivery token. Requests are idempotent per donation identifier; duplicates return the original token. For release validation, point the client at the staging cluster and confirm a two-hundred response before promoting. Authentication uses a static internal key, supplied below for the staging environment.

API key for tagef-fafop: vxb2-ta

The Plover address autocomplete widget queries the Lanewise suggestion service on each keystroke after a 300ms debounce. Results are scoped to the tenant's configured region list and capped at eight entries. Requests are signed client-side, so the embedding page needs no proxy. Initialize the widget with the key issued for our internal environment, shown below.

gateway credential: kto23_LX9A4ys6i4nzHtpOLNLodKK